bio

chicago, il, 1996. Two electronic musicians each with their own solo music projects armed with pro tracker, fast tracker and impulse tracker on pre-intel computers, each with their own hobbies of making and manipulating tape recordings of strange electronic noises as well as making pause-record tape to tape mixes from radio clips and various sources, joined to form monstrum sepsis.
